Transaction f6164e96010f3211794213402415858075853ee053852ea8339b51aed31c2448

1 Input
2 Outputs
  • f6164e96010f3211794213402415858075853ee053852ea8339b51aed31c2448:0
  • value  4546376
    address  17HZUo4RCDjYxmcRqGrQ6tiYmGsAeoV1dN
  • f6164e96010f3211794213402415858075853ee053852ea8339b51aed31c2448:1
  • value  13906367
    address  33jGrVwE5WiRcwcTw1zA7iRKryYVYQL4mj